Chamera Lake is a picturesque man-made reservoir on the Ravi River caused by the construction of the Chamera Dam, located close to the town of Dalhousie in Himachal Pradesh in Northern India. The lake is famous for its exquisite clear waters and surrounded by beautiful and lush nature the lake is a popular tourist destination. The lake is an adventurer’s haven for boating, water sports, trekking, and camping, drawing visitors who want an adventure and also love nature. The tranquil environment is also a lovely place to relax and take images. The most favorable time to visit is from March to June when the weather is great for outdoor activities. Winter from October to February has misty and peaceful landscapes. The time of July to September is the monsoon that brings beautiful photography because the fields of green grass look obvious.  

About Chamera Lake

Formation: Artificial lake created by the Chamera Dam on the Ravi River

The Chamera Lake was created to produce hydroelectricity when the Chamera Dam was built on the Ravi River. Whereas, the projects support the electricity and irrigation needs of the area, the lake provides a major location for regional tourism – the lake and dam are heavily visited sites.

Scenic beauty: Surrounded by lush green mountains and deep valleys

Lush green mountains and deep valleys surround the lake, adding to its scenic beauty. With its rolling hills and thick pine forests, Chamera Lake offers breathtaking views. The emerald green waters contrast with the lake greenery, making it perfect for outdoor photographers.

Altitude and geographical significance

At an elevation of 763 meters, the Chamera Lake Project plays a key role in hydropower projects in Himachal Pradesh. The lake serves as an important water reservoir for the area, and it provides a good retreat for travelers who want to experience nature.

How to Reach Chamera Lake

1. By Road 

● Distance from Dalhousie (25 km)

The lake is 25 km away from Dalhousie; it is a short distance and an easy drive through the mountain roads that wind around. 

● Nearby towns and road conditions

The lake is accessible from Chamba, Dalhousie, and Khajjiar. The roads and access were well maintained; however, sections of the trip did have some narrow winding roads.

2. By Air

● Nearest Aiport

Kangra Airport (approx 120 km) The closest airport is the Kangra Airport about 120 km away from Dalhousie. 

● Availability of taxis and public transport.

Taxis and buses are available to reach Dalhousie and Chamera Lake from there. There are taxis, regular buses, and frequent private vehicles once you connect with Pathankot to reach Dalhousie, then Chamera Lake.

3. By Train

● Nearest Railway Station 

Pathankot (120 km) Pathankot is the nearest major railway station connecting Chamera Lake to several cities including Delhi, Amritsar, and Chandigarh.

● Connectivity with major cities

Several regular city trains as a whole make Pathankot a relatively simple option to return to Pathankot and then to Chamera Lake by road.

Chamera Lake Nearby Attractions

● Khajjiar – 

The Mini Switzerland of India. 

Only around 40km away, Khajjiar is an emerald green meadow nestled between deodar forests, and it resembles a fantasy landscape.

● Dalhousie – 

Colonial heritage and breathtaking views.

Dalhousie is another place with colonial-era charm, churches, and breathtaking views, and it is a place to visit before or after the visit to Chamera Lake.

● Kalatop Wildlife Sanctuary – 

Heaven for nature lovers.

Kalatop Sanctuary is located near Dalhousie and is home to Himalayan black bears, leopards, and a variety of birds, and so is also a haven for wildlife lovers.

Chamera Lake: Travel Tips for Visitors

● Ideal clothing and essentials based on the season.

In summer pack light clothing, in winter pack warm layers, and have rain gear on hand for monsoon. And also sturdy and comfortable shoes for trekking. 

● Best local eateries and food to try near Chamera Lake

If you’re seeking true Himachali food try some of the local restaurants in Dalhousie and Chamba for Sidu (steamed bread), Chana Madra (chickpea curry), or Dham (a traditional meal). 

● Safety precautions for boating and trekking.

Always follow boat safety rules and wear a life jacket while on the water. If you’re not familiar with the trails while trekking, engage a local guide to go with you.
